Water Pumps for 2004 for BMW 3 Series
Shop by category
476 results
Sort: Best Match
NEW Water Pump w/ Seal for BMW E46 E90 E91 E83 E88 318i 316i 320i 118i 120i (for: BMW 3 Series 2004)
Brand new · UnbrandedAU $59.99or Best OfferFree postage348 sold- AU $115.89Was: AU $226.80was AU $226.80AU $52.59 postage
- AU $113.72Was: AU $226.80was AU $226.80AU $52.49 postage
- AU $108.55Was: AU $194.41was AU $194.41AU $52.24 postage
- Brand new · TOPRANAU $246.99or Best OfferFree postageOnly 1 left!
- Brand new · GatesAU $78.95Was: AU $94.74was AU $94.74Free postage29 sold
- Brand newAU $64.96Was: AU $70.61was AU $70.61Free postage180 sold
- AU $39.00Free postageOnly 3 left
- AU $100.08or Best OfferFree postage
- Brand new · DaycoAU $76.99Free postage3 watching
- Brand new · ProtexAU $68.42AU $18.00 postage
NEW Water Pump w/ Seal for BMW E46 E90 E91 E83 E88 318i 316i 320i 118i 120i (for: BMW 3 Series 2004)
Brand newAU $45.95Was: AU $93.90was AU $93.90Free postage- Brand new · DaycoAU $96.95Was: AU $116.34was AU $116.34Free postage10 watching
- AU $111.78Was: AU $194.41was AU $194.41AU $52.39 postage
- AU $108.31Was: AU $194.41was AU $194.41AU $52.22 postage
- AU $109.07Was: AU $194.41was AU $194.41AU $52.26 postage
- AU $36.00or Best OfferFree postage
- Brand new · UnbrandedAU $48.99or Best OfferFree postageOnly 1 left!
- Professional AutoParts Supplier✔ TS16949 CERT✔ AU LOCALBrand new · UnbrandedAU $35.99or Best OfferFree postage45 sold
- Brand new · GatesAU $128.46Was: AU $151.13was AU $151.13Free postage
- Brand newAU $660.00Free postageEst. delivery Thu, Sep 4Only 1 left!
- Brand new · GatesAU $47.98Trending at AU $57.13AU $5.00 postage
- Brand new · GatesAU $78.95Was: AU $94.74was AU $94.74Free postage
- AU $35.99or Best OfferFree postage94 sold
- Brand new · UnbrandedAU $59.99or Best OfferFree postageOnly 2 left
- Brand new · ProtexAU $75.87Was: AU $77.03was AU $77.03Free postage
- Brand new · UnbrandedAU $64.55or Best OfferFree postage
- Brand new · GatesAU $1,141.95Was: AU $1,370.34was AU $1,370.34Free postage
- AU $96.01Was: AU $172.25was AU $172.25AU $51.64 postage
- Pre-owned · BMWAU $113.70or Best OfferFree postage
- AU $113.33Was: AU $194.41was AU $194.41AU $52.47 postage
- AU $134.79Was: AU $255.44was AU $255.44AU $53.48 postage
Dayco Automotive Engine Water Pump fits BMW 3 Series 3.0 E46 330 Ci (DP269) (for: BMW 3 Series 2004)
Brand new · DaycoAU $79.00Was: AU $87.78was AU $87.78Free postage- AU $36.00or Best OfferFree postage
- AU $69.00Free postage4 watching
- AU $51.58AU $49.53 postage
- Brand new · DaycoAU $96.95Was: AU $116.34was AU $116.34Free postage11 watching
- Brand new · UnbrandedAU $40.50or Best OfferFree postage
- AU $138.55Was: AU $301.06was AU $301.06AU $53.67 postage
- AU $132.27AU $53.36 postage
- AU $37.95Was: AU $67.90was AU $67.90Free postageOnly 1 left!
- Brand new · UnbrandedAU $37.50or Best OfferFree postage44 sold
- Brand newAU $58.00Free postage
- Brand new · PierburgAU $819.95Free postage
- AU $63.41or Best OfferFree postage
- AU $444.96Was: AU $533.95was AU $533.95Free postage
- Brand new · BMWAU $185.00AU $5.00 postage
- AU $64.95Was: AU $109.90was AU $109.90Free postageOnly 2 left
- Brand new · GMBAU $81.95Was: AU $98.34was AU $98.34Free postage
- AU $100.55or Best OfferFree postage
- AU $186.95Free postage
- Brand new · ProtexAU $88.77Was: AU $104.43was AU $104.43Free postage
- AU $74.08or Best OfferFree postage
- Brand newAU $499.00Free postageEst. delivery Thu, Sep 4Only 1 left!
- Brand new · ATP (Automatic Transmission Parts Inc.)AU $59.99Free postage
- Brand new · UnbrandedAU $50.55or Best OfferFree postage
- Brand new · UnbrandedAU $74.99or Best OfferFree postage2 watching
- Brand new · ATP (Automatic Transmission Parts Inc.)AU $40.00Free postage
- Brand new · PremierAU $119.14Was: AU $267.32was AU $267.32AU $52.74 postage
- AU $111.01Was: AU $194.41was AU $194.41AU $52.36 postage